**Build Provenance: Request Tracing Across Services**

Plugin authors integrating with the Ostermere platform must propagate the tracing header unchanged through every downstream call. Each microservice appends its build fingerprint to the span metadata, allowing the provenance auditor to reconstruct exactly which artifact handled a request. When filing a compatibility report, always quote the originating trace token, which appears below this paragraph.

session token of tajog-fahaf = htk21_4ae55819f45410afcb307

## Ownership: Encoding Detection

The charset sniffer in `textintake/encoding` guesses encodings for uploaded text files in Fernwhistle. It handles BOM checks, UTF-8 validation, and a statistical fallback for legacy codepages. Do not tweak the confidence thresholds without a regression run against the corpus fixtures — past "small" changes broke Cyrillic detection twice. New team members: read the fixture README before touching anything. All changes route through one owner for review.

named custodian: Brivan Eliath Quenox Frador

Ticket: Staging env misconfigured for Siftgate bloom filter

The bloom layer in front of the Pellet KV store is rejecting all lookups in staging because the env file was copied from the dev template without credentials. False-positive tuning values are fine; only the auth line is missing. To unblock the weekly demo, the Pellet admission secret must be set on the following line.

env line for yaguf-fajop: LEDGER_TOKEN13=fb08984397349

Ticket: Circuit breaker for the Quillgate upstream API trips too eagerly. During Tuesday's load test, the breaker in our Harborline gateway opened after only three timeouts within a ten-second window, starving healthy traffic. Proposed fix: widen the window to thirty seconds and require five consecutive failures. For the weekly eng sync, please review against the reproduction run whose trace token follows.

build token for yajof-bajof: htk31_506ff1188f74596b5bb2eec94edc43c